Key Topics Covered
Foundational Elements of Networking
To provide a clearer insight into what participants can expect to learn, here is a breakdown of the major topics addressed in the course:
- Software Defined Networking (SDN):
- Understand the need for SDN in cloud infrastructure.
- Explore how SDN simplifies network management.
- Load Balancing:
- Learn about different types of load balancers available in GCP.
- Understand how load balancing enhances application availability and reliability.
- Auto-Scaling:
- Discover how cloud services automatically adjust resources based on demand.
- Analyze practical case studies demonstrating auto-scaling in action.
- Virtual Private Clouds (VPCs):
- Get acquainted with the architecture of VPCs and their significance in network design.
- Learn configuration methods for optimal performance and security.
- Identity and Access Management (IAM):
- Examine IAM from a networking perspective.
- Understand its importance in maintaining secure access to resources.
